Water Damage Mitigation v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water spill (less than 10 gallons) | Yes | No | You can likely handle a small spill on your own with some towels and a wet/dry vacuum. |
| Large water spill (more than 10 gallons) | No | Yes | A large spill needs specialized equipment and expertise to handle safely and effectively. |
| Water damage behind walls or ceilings | No | Yes | You can't see what's going on behind walls or ceilings, and trying to fix it yourself can lead to further damage. |
| Water damage affecting electrical systems | No | Yes | Electrical systems can be hazardous when exposed to water, and only a professional should handle this type of situation. |
| Water damage affecting structural elements (e.g., beams, joists) | No | Yes | Structural elements can be compromised by water damage, and only a professional should assess and repair this type of damage. |

Water Damage Mitigation Cost in White Oak, OH
The cost of Water Damage Mitigation can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in White Oak, OH. Here are some estimated price ranges for different aspects of Water Damage Mitigation: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ment and Containment | $500 - $2,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 - $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used |
| Moisture Reading and Inspection | $200 - $1,000 | Size of affected area, complexity of inspection |
| Remediation and Repair | $2,000 - $10,000 | Severity of damage, type of repair needed |

Common Questions About Water Damage Mitigation
Q: What causes water damage in my home?
A: Water damage can be caused by a variety of factors, including leaks, floods, appliance malfunctions, and poor maintenance. It's essential to address water damage quickly to prevent further damage and costly repairs.
Q: How long does it take to complete a Water Damage Mitigation job?
A: The length of time it takes to complete a Water Damage Mitigation job depends on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the type of equipment used. But, our team works efficiently to get the job done as quickly as possible, usually within 3-5 days.
Q: Do I need to move out of my home during the Water Damage Mitigation process?
A: In most cases, you can stay in your home during the Water Damage Mitigation process. But, if the damage is severe or extensive, it may be necessary to relocate temporarily until the job is complete.
Q: Is Water Damage Mitigation covered by insurance?
A: In most cases, water damage is covered by homeowners' insurance. But, it's essential to review your policy and contact your insurance provider to find out what is covered and what is not.
Q: Can I prevent water damage from happening in the first place?
A: Yes, there are steps you can take to prevent water damage from occurring. Regular maintenance, inspecting your home's plumbing and appliances, and addressing leaks quickly can all help prevent water damage.
